This page summarises the agreed sale of the Coldmere Fabrication Unit to Aldervane Industrial. Completion is expected next quarter, subject to regulatory clearance in Tresmont. All Coldmere staff transfer under existing terms; branch managers should route any queries to the transition office rather than answering directly. Customer contracts novate automatically at completion. Please read the full FAQ before briefing teams. The confidential note below describes the business plans following completion.

confidential, kagup-bafog: Fraaxax Group is in early talks to buy Soroxox Group for about $343.8 million. The Olidor launch date is June 14, and nothing goes to the press before then. Legal wants the Aldmirek Logistics term sheet signed before July 23.

- [ ] **Step 7: Breaker override escrow.** After sealing the signing keys for the Tallgrove upstream API circuit breaker, confirm the support team can force the breaker open during a full outage. The override bundle lives in the sealed escrow drawer and is useless without its unlock phrase. Two ceremony witnesses must initial this step before proceeding. The escrow bundle is decrypted with the recovery passphrase that follows.

vault phrase of kahip-kahop = holath-quenmir

Quellstack sits between our monitoring stack and the paging system. It groups alerts by fingerprint, collapsing repeats within a five-minute window so on-call engineers get one page per incident instead of dozens. Suppression rules live in a versioned config repo; changes deploy automatically after review. New team members should shadow one tuning session before editing rules, since an overly broad rule can silence real incidents. Bring questions to the weekly eng sync, or send them ahead of time here.

escalation mailbox, bafog-fafog: ulador@paliqlabs.internal

# Brindlewick Match Service — Environments

This page documents GC pause behavior across environments for reviewers assessing latency changes. Staging runs a smaller heap and shows pauses under 40 ms; production's larger heap historically hit 300 ms until we tuned the collector last quarter. Any change touching allocation paths should be benchmarked against both. The production tuning values are as follows.

deployment values, hahip-kajep:
HOLAX_PIN=4003
HOLAX_METRICS_HOST=metrics.holax.zemvarworks.internal
HOLAX_LOG_LEVEL=warn
HOLAX_TENANT=fraael